    A "Service of Welcome" is scheduled forSeptember 23 at 3:00 pm at Murfreesboro 1st UMC.

    The Committee on Episcopacy and the Extended Cabinet offer a special invitation to the TNConference and friends to "A Service of Welcome for Bishop Bill McAlilly." Reception to follow

    immediately after the worship service.

    Bishop-elect McAlilly comes from the MS Conference UMC and is curren

    District Superintendent of the Seashore District. A small portion of his bio

    reads: He leads the heart of the church into the heart of mission as

    evidenced by his call to the MS GulfCoast and in forming a partnershipbetween Seashore District and the Methodist Church of Nicaragua, now amission emphasis of the Mississippi Conference. He serves as a member

    the HolyConferencing Task Force leading toward General Conference 20

    and was a contributor to the book,The Gift of Unity, edited by Bishop ScoJones.

    Labor Day, the first Monday in September, is a creation of the labor

    movement and is dedicated to the social and economic achievements of

    American workers. It constitutes a yearly national tribute to thecontributions workers have made to the strength, prosperity, and well-

    being of our country. It started in 1882.**But lets have a shout out to the Rosie in us!

    The magazine cover exemplified the American can-do spirit and

    illustrated the notion of women working in previously male-

    dominated manufacturing jobs, an ever-growing reality, to help the

    United States fight the war while the men fought over seas.
